Google Docs and Zoho Writer have been the main competitors for online word processors for some time now, with both fighting it out to see who reigns supreme for this potentially lucrative market. It would be a big blow to one side or the other based on who was able to take their word processor out of the online only arena and into the desktop realm. And Zoho Writer came out on top yesterday morning - using Google’s own new Google Gears functionality. All you need to do to take advantage of Zoho (online and off) is sign up for an account and then visit Google’s Google Gears site and download the Firefox or Internet Explorer extension. Makes a great alternative to Microsoft Word or some of the free word processors out there, and it works for Linux, Mac OSX, and Windows.
